FAQs
Since when has Corrosion been publishing? 
The Corrosion has been publishing since 1945 till date.
How frequently is the Corrosion published? 
Corrosion is published Monthly.
What is the H-index. SNIP score, Citescore and SJR of Corrosion? 
Corrosion has a H-index score of 97, Citescore of 4.4, SNIP score of 0.86, & SJR of Q2
Who is the publisher of Corrosion? 
The publisher of Corrosion is NATL ASSOC CORROSION ENG.
How can I view the journal metrics of Corrosion on editage? 
For the Corrosion metrics, please refer to the section above on the page.
What is the eISSN and pISSN number of Corrosion? 
The eISSN number is 1938-159X and pISSN number is 0010-9312 for Corrosion.
